摘 要:近年来海城河生态水量不足,难以保障水生态系统稳定发展。本文对海城河不同生态保护目标的生态需水量进行计算和分析,采用Tennant法计算保障河道生态基流的需水量,基于鱼类健康生存条件计算保障河流生态系统健康发展的生态需水量,采用环境功能设定法计算河流的各环境功能需水量。计算结果表明:保障河道生态基流的生态需水量为0.88×10^(8)m^(3),保障河道内全部环境功能的生态需水量为1.72×10^(8)m^(3),保障河流生态系统健康发展的生态需水量为3.04×10^(8)m^(3);近十年海城河的生态基流需水量可以得到基本满足,水生态系统稳定发展的最佳需水量满足度较低。In recent years,the lack of ecological water in Haicheng River makes it difficult to ensure the steady development of water ecosystem.In this paper,the demand of Haicheng River for ecological water is calculated and analyzed for different ecological protection objectives,the Tennant method is used to calculate the basic demand of river courses for water flow.The demand of river ecosystem for ecological water was calculated based on fish healthy living conditions.The environmental function setting method is adopted to calculate the water demand of each environmental function of the river.The calculation results show that:the demand for ecological water to ensure the basic flow demand of the river is 0.88×10^(8)m^(3),the demand for ecological water to ensure all environmental functions in the river is 1.72×10^(8)m^(3),the optimal demand for water to ensure the stable development of the aquatic ecosystem is 3.04×10^(8)m^(3).In recent ten years,the ecological water requirement of the basic flow of Haicheng River can be basically satisfied,but the optimal water requirement of the stable development of water ecosystem is low.
关 键 词:生态需水 鱼类生存条件 生态保护目标 TENNANT法 环境功能设定法
